flag Israel seized a Lebanese student in a maritime raid, claiming he led Hezbollah’s covert naval unit, sparking international condemnation.

flag Israel captured Imad Amhaz, a Lebanese man from Batroun studying maritime sciences, in a November 2024 raid using a radar-jamming speedboat, claiming he was a central figure in Hezbollah’s covert maritime unit. flag The IDF said Amhaz helped plan a network to smuggle weapons and conduct attacks under civilian cover, with operations allegedly overseen by Hezbollah leaders. flag His capture disrupted the group’s naval ambitions, according to Israel, which released an interrogation video naming key figures. flag Lebanon condemned the abduction as a war crime and violation of sovereignty. flag Despite a November ceasefire, Israel continues strikes and maintains troops in five southern areas.
